Tunnel North is the name given to the northern end of the Moelwyn Tunnel. It was the construction site of a cutting on the Deviation. Work started here in January 1972 with ground clearance by the FR's excavator, followed by blasting of rock by a contractor in July, then rock clearance by volunteers.
